#687685 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#687685 is composed of 40.8% red, 46.3%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.8% cyan, 11.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 211 degrees, a saturation of 12.2% and a lightness of 46.5%. #687685 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ecff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#687685 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#687685 has RGB values of R:104, G:118,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 6846085.

Shades and Tints of #687685
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#687685
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#71767c is the less saturated color, while #0473e9 is the most saturated one.
